Official Features: What Xiaomi Says
According to the manufacturerβs specifications, the Xiaomi Redmi 9 is equipped with four rear cameras, as they are presented in official materials:
- πΈ Main camera: 13 MP, diaphragm f/2.2, phase-focus (PDAF)
- π Wide-angle camera: 8 MP, angle of view 118Β°, diaphragm f/2.2
- π Macro camera: 5 MP, focal length 2 diaphragm f/2.4
- π‘ Deep camera: 2 MP, diaphragm f/2.4 (portrait-mode)
On paper, this looks impressive for the budget segment, but in practice it is not so rosy, because software optimization plays a key role: some cameras only work in certain modes, and their actual resolution may differ from what they claim due to pixel binning or interpolation.
The Real Number of Cameras: Myths and Truth
If you look closely at the back of the Redmi 9, you can see four separate lenses in a vertical block, but physicality doesn't equal functional utility. Let's see which ones actually affect the quality of the shot.
- The main camera (13 MP) is the only module that is used 90% of the time, and it is responsible for shooting in automatic mode, HDR and video.
- Wide-angle (8 MP) β useful for landscapes or architecture, but loses in detail at the edges of the frame.
- Macro camera (5 MP) β can be useful for shooting small objects, but its quality leaves much to be desired.
- The depth camera (2 MP) is used exclusively to create the bokeh effect in portrait mode. It does not take a photo by itself.
So there are three functional cameras: the main, wide-angle and macro. The fourth is more of a marketing move than a real need. Moreover, in some regions (for example, in India) the Redmi 9 Prime version with a triple camera was sold, where the macro module was replaced with a depth sensor with a different resolution.

Comparison with competitors: who offers more
When Redmi 9 was released in 2020, most budget smartphones had either a dual or triple camera, and a four-modular system was a rarity in the segment.
| Model | Number of cameras | Core module | Additional modules |
|---|---|---|---|
| Samsung Galaxy M11 | 3 | 13 MP, f/1.8 | 5 MP (wide-angle), 2 MP (depth) |
| Realme Narzo 10A | 3 | 12 MP, f/1.8 | 2 MP (macro), 2 MP (depth) |
| Redmi 9 | 4 | 13 MP, f/2.2 | 8 MP (wide-angle), 5 MP (macro), 2 MP (depth) |
| Nokia 5.3 | 4 | 13 MP, f/1.8 | 5 MP (wide-angle), 2 MP (macro), 2 MP (depth) |
As you can see from the table, the Xiaomi Redmi 9 was not a pioneer in terms of camera count, but offered a more balanced set of modules. For example, it had a wide-angle camera at 8 MP higher resolution than its competitors. On the other hand, the Samsung Galaxy M11 lost in the number of modules, but won in the aperture of the main camera (f/1.8 vs f/2.2).
β οΈ Note: When comparing cameras, pay attention not only to megapixels, but also to pixel size and aperture. For example, 13 MP with a pixel of 1.12 microns will be worse than 12 MP with a pixel of 1.4 microns in low light conditions.
How to Use Redmi 9 Cameras as Effectively as You Can
Even with limited camera capabilities, Redmi 9 can achieve good results if you know a few tricks.
Main chamber (13 MP)
- π Use the regimen. HDR In bright sun or contrast light, it turns on automatically, but you can fix it in the settings.
- π In the dark, activate the night mode (keep the smartphone as still as possible). 2-3 seconds).
- π― For moving objects, use continuous shooting (hold down the down button).
Wide-angle camera (8 MP)
- ποΈ Perfect for architecture and landscapes, but avoid shooting against the light β there will be strong glare.
- π Keep the subject closer to the center of the frame, as there are distortions along the edges ("barrel effect").
- π« Donβt use it for portraits β the faces on the edges will be unnaturally elongated.

Macro camera (5 MP)
This module is the most capricious, to get an acceptable result:
- π΅οΈββοΈ Bring your smartphone to a distance 2-4 cm to the object (closer or further - will be blurred).
- π‘ Shoot in good lighting - the matrix is too small for low light.
- πΌοΈ Use post-processing (e.g. Snapseed or Lightroom Mobile) to improve clarity.
β οΈ Attention: Redmi 9's Macro Camera doesn't have autofocus. If an object is moving (like an insect), you'll have to adjust the distance manually, which is extremely inconvenient.
Frequent Redmi 9 Camera Issues and How to Solve Them
Redmi 9 users often face typical camera-related issues, and here are the most common ones and how to fix them:
1. Blurred photos in automatic mode
Reasons:
- Dirty lens (wipe with a soft cloth).
- Trembling hands (use a timer or external support).
- Low lighting (turn on night mode or use an external light source).
2.Wide-angle camera gives purple glare
This is a defect of many budget wide-angle modules.
- Change the angle of shooting so that the sun does not hit the lens directly.
- Use post-processing apps (such as Adobe Lightroom) to correct color balance.
3.Portrait mode poorly separates the object from the background
The depth chamber (2 MP) is low resolution, so it often makes mistakes with the boundaries.
- Shooting is carried out at a distance of 1-1.5 meters from the object.
- Use a contrasting background (for example, a light object on a dark background).
- Manually adjust the mask in the editor (for example, in Focos for the iOS/Android).

If the Redmi 9 camera starts to βglutchβ (hang, give out a green screen), try resetting the Camera app settings in the Settings menu β Apps β Camera β Storage β Reset. This often helps without completely resetting the phone.
